GLEANNTÁN FROLICS [1], THE. AKA and see "Pádraig O'Keeffe's." Irish, Slide (12/8 time). D Major. Standard tuning (fiddle). AABB.

Source for notated version: accordion player Johnny O'Leary (Sliabh Luachra regin of the Cork-Kerry border) [Moylan].

Printed sources: Moylan (Johnny O'Leary), 1994; No. 192, p. 111.

Recorded sources: RTE CD174, "The Sliabh Luachra Fiddle Master Padraig O'Keeffe."
